Stopping unwanted app notifications depends on the device you use. Here are the most common methods for Android phones, iPhones, and computers.
1. On Android Phones
-
Open Settings.
-
Tap Notifications.
-
Select App notifications.
-
Choose the app sending unwanted alerts.
-
Toggle Allow notifications off.
Quick method:
-
Press and hold the notification when it appears.
-
Tap Turn off notifications or Settings.
This is the fastest way to stop alerts from a specific app.
2. On iPhone
-
Open Settings.
-
Tap Notifications.
-
Select the app you want.
-
Turn off Allow Notifications.
You can also disable:
-
Lock Screen notifications
-
Sounds
-
Badges
This allows you to customise what alerts you still want.
3. On Windows Computer
-
Open Settings.
-
Click System.
-
Select Notifications.
-
Turn off notifications for specific apps.
4. On Web Browsers (Chrome, Edge, etc.)
Sometimes websites send notifications.
-
Open browser Settings.
-
Go to Privacy & Security.
-
Click Site Settings → Notifications.
-
Block or remove websites sending alerts.
5. Use Do Not Disturb Mode
If you want temporary silence:
-
Turn on Do Not Disturb in your phone’s quick settings.
-
Notifications will be muted for a chosen time.
✅ Tip: Many apps (like social media or shopping apps) also have notification settings inside the app itself. Turning them off there can reduce spam alerts.
